Material: Plate die-cast zinc or SS steel 1.4305.
Damper plate PUR elastomere (Sylomer V12).
Model: Die-cast zinc plate, black powder-coated. SS steel plate, . Damper plate, grey, glued in, anti-slip. Temp. range -30 °C to +70 °C.

Note for ordering:If the swivel foot plate and the threaded spindle or ball joint are to be supplied assembled, please add the suffix “assembled” to the order number for the plate and the spindle or ball joint. (e.g. 27804-20601 and 27810-060151 assembled.)
Note:The load rating given in the table is a rECOmmendation of the permanent static load up to which the absorption unit should be used. This static load corresponds to a pressure per area of 0.4 N/mm², at which the material achieves its optimum absorption properties. Here it is taken into account that under dynamic demands an additional load, up to 0.6 N/mm² may occur. The damper plate absorbs vibrations and prevents the swivel foot slipping. Swivel feet consist of a plate and a threaded spindle or ball joint. Any plate can be combined with any threaded spindle or ball joint. For matching threaded spindles see 27810. For matching ball joints see 27811.
